And Now My Lifesong Sings
Casting Crowns' song "And Now My Lifesong Sings" is a worship anthem about personal transformation through faith in Jesus Christ. The lyrics echo the testimony of being lost and found, blind and seeing, dead and alive—drawing from the biblical story of the blind man healed by Jesus. The song expresses gratitude for salvation and a commitment to live for God, with the repeated phrase "now my lifesong sings" symbolizing a life devoted to worship. It is a declaration of new life and surrender, celebrating the change that comes from encountering Christ.
